Ordinals
beta
Sat 939902144964217
decimal
187980.2144964217
degree
0°187980′492″2144964217‴
percentile
44.75724504752904%
name
heqgwofqovw
cycle
0
epoch
0
period
93
block
187980
offset
2144964217
timestamp
2012-07-07 16:08:18 UTC
rarity
common
prev
next